It was late in the evening when we arrived at the Mangole family home at Matamoreng ward in Mochudi. Members of the family were seated near their burnt two-roomed house. A few meters away from the house were burnt mattresses taken out of the house during the fire on that fateful day.
Salome Mangole and the children waited patiently for the Mmegi team.
